Porsche - Deactivation of passenger frontal air bags

An official NHTSA notice concerns Porsche - Deactivation of passenger frontal air bags. The intermittent plug may cause the passenger seat frontal and knee airbags may be deactivated. In the event of a crash necessitating airbag deployment, this may increase the risk of injury to the front passenger. Published 2013-10-17.
What to do now
Porsche will notify owners, and dealers will replace the front passenger seat free of charge. The recall began on december 11, 2013. Owners may contact porsche at 1-770-290-3500. Porsche's recall number is ad04.
